Multiply: `-3/2"x"^5"y"^3` and `4/9"a"^2"x"3"y"`

`(-3/2"x"^5"y"^3) (4/9"a"^2"x"^3"y")`
=`(-3/2xx4/9)("a"^2)("x"^5xx"x"^3)("y"^3xx"y")`
= `(-2)/3 "a"^2"x"^8"y"^4`
